There will be a chance to get an early start to your Christmas shopping and pamper yourself with a beauty treatment as Care UK’s Heather View residential home in Beacon Road, Crowborough, opens its doors to visitors on Saturday 24th November.
The Christmas market promises to solve everyone’s present problems. Organiser Marion Wickison said: “We have some fantastic stalls selling handmade goods, jewellery and cards and our own Knit Club will have a stall.”
There will also an opportunity for shoppers to pamper themselves with beauty treatments, including manicures and eyebrow shaping, provided by the home’s qualified hairdresser Louise Kaszuba.
Marion said: “We hope the fair will be opened by Father Christmas and the members of the East Sussex Fire Brigade, emergencies permitting, and children will be able to visit Santa in his Grotto.
“We hope that the community will come and join in with our carolling and see our beautiful home, as well as stocking up with their presents and having a pamper session with our beauticians.”
The Christmas market is free and open to the public from 1-4pm and refreshments, including mince pies, will be available in the home’s Doyle’s coffee shop.
